Ahmad sold 125 shares of stock for x dollars that he had purchased for $32.75 per share.
a. How much did he originally pay for the shares of the stock?
125*32.75 = 4093.75
---------------------------
b. Write an inequality that represents an amount such that Ahmad made money from the sale of stocks.
Gain >= 125x-4093.75
---------------------------
c. Suppose Ahmad lost money on the stocks. Write an inequality that represents an amount such that Ahmad lost no more than $1,000 from the sale of the stocks 
4093.75-125x <= 1000
